假設我有一個非常簡單的ASCII文件,只包含如何知道一個非常小的文件的大小?
11111111
現在,我想用一個命令來找出多少字節是真的有,沒有多少字節分配給它的系統。我試圖
ln -s
和
du
,但他們只輸出
4
我認爲這是該系統有多少塊分配這個文件,我怎麼可以用一個命令來查找這樣一個小文件的大小?
假設我有一個非常簡單的ASCII文件,只包含如何知道一個非常小的文件的大小?
11111111
現在,我想用一個命令來找出多少字節是真的有,沒有多少字節分配給它的系統。我試圖
ln -s
和
du
,但他們只輸出
4
我認爲這是該系統有多少塊分配這個文件,我怎麼可以用一個命令來查找這樣一個小文件的大小?
您需要使用du -b
以字節爲單位查看文件大小。
$ du -b file
9 file
您可以使用stat
命令獲取有關文件的信息。例如,文件的字節大小爲:
$ echo "11111111" > file
$ stat -c %s file
9
類型man stat
看到所有的其他有用的東西它可以告訴你有關的文件。
wc -c
會做:
$ echo "11111111" > file
$ wc -c file
9 file